Deep Purple photo

Deep Purple setlist at DTE Energy Music Theatre in Clarkston, United States on September 3, 2017

Deep Purple setlist on September 3, 2017 at DTE Energy Music Theatre in Clarkston, United States on tour The Long Goodbye